Six Sonatas For Two Flutes Or Violins, Volume 1 (#1-3) (Heft 1). By Georg Philipp Telemann (1681-1767). Edited by Gunter Hausswald. For two flutes (or two violins). This edition: Stapled, Urtext edition. Stapled. Volume I. Baroque. Difficulty: medium. Flute duet score (2 copies necessary for performance). Duet notation and introductory text. Opus 2, TWV 40:101, 102, 104. 25 pages. Published by Baerenreiter Verlag (BA.BA2979).

ISBN 9790006428311. With duet notation and introductory text. Baroque. 9x12 inches.

Six sonatas in two volumes. Volume 2 (sonatas #4-6) available BA2980.

Great additon to Duet repertoire

These sonatas are very pleasing to play between two equal partners. The parts have great beauty, and they are most satisfying to play. A welcome addition to any duet music you may have. For violinists, there are no fingerings suggested.
